1、mycat,仅支持XA/2pc两阶段提交事务。
2、ShardingSphere
3、分库分表策略
主键ID取模
区间范围
日期
4、shardingsphere自定义符合分片算法
5、shardingsphere 支持的事务
local,
xa(2阶段提交,事务协调器预提交,检查所有预提交都成功后再提交,事务性能比local低很多,xa-atomiks)
,base(柔性事务)
6、saga协议,华为service comb,基于事件驱动,基于saga-log逆向补偿回滚,不适合激烈竞争的场景中。
7、seata支持事务隔离,性能比comb稍低。
8、tcc(三阶段提交 try-comfirm-cancle)基于业务try try,confirm
分库分表插件
最新推荐文章于 2024-07-15 11:19:07 发布